Changeset 7aa1685 in sasview for calculatorview/src
- Timestamp:
- Apr 24, 2013 12:16:12 PM (12 years ago)
- Branches:
- master, ESS_GUI, ESS_GUI_Docs, ESS_GUI_batch_fitting, ESS_GUI_bumps_abstraction, ESS_GUI_iss1116, ESS_GUI_iss879, ESS_GUI_iss959, ESS_GUI_opencl, ESS_GUI_ordering, ESS_GUI_sync_sascalc, costrafo411, magnetic_scatt, release-4.1.1, release-4.1.2, release-4.2.2, release_4.0.1, ticket-1009, ticket-1094-headless, ticket-1242-2d-resolution, ticket-1243, ticket-1249, ticket885, unittest-saveload
- Children:
- b07ffca
- Parents:
- 9159cb9
- Location:
- calculatorview/src/sans/perspectives/calculator
- Files:
-
- 8 edited
Legend:
- Unmodified
- Added
- Removed
-
calculatorview/src/sans/perspectives/calculator/calculator.py
rae84427 r7aa1685 113 113 manager=self, data=[], 114 114 title="Data Editor") 115 self.put_icon(self.data_edit_frame) 116 self.data_edit_frame.Show(False) 115 #self.put_icon(self.data_edit_frame) 116 else: 117 self.data_edit_frame.Show(False) 117 118 self.data_edit_frame.Show(True) 118 119 … … 126 127 manager=self, 127 128 title="Data Operation") 128 self.put_icon(self.data_operator_frame) 129 self.data_operator_frame.Show(False) 129 #self.put_icon(self.data_operator_frame) 130 else: 131 self.data_operator_frame.Show(False) 130 132 self.data_operator_frame.panel.set_panel_on_focus(None) 131 133 self.data_operator_frame.Show(True) … … 137 139 if self.kiessig_frame == None: 138 140 frame = KiessigWindow(parent=self.parent, manager=self) 139 self.put_icon(frame)141 #self.put_icon(frame) 140 142 self.kiessig_frame = frame 141 self.kiessig_frame.Show(False) 143 else: 144 self.kiessig_frame.Show(False) 142 145 self.kiessig_frame.Show(True) 143 146 … … 147 150 """ 148 151 if self.sld_frame == None: 149 frame = SldWindow(base=self.parent, manager=self) 150 self.put_icon(frame) 152 frame = SldWindow(parent=self.parent, 153 base=self.parent, manager=self) 154 #self.put_icon(frame) 151 155 self.sld_frame = frame 152 self.sld_frame.Show(False) 156 else: 157 self.sld_frame.Show(False) 153 158 self.sld_frame.Show(True) 154 159 … … 158 163 """ 159 164 if self.cal_md_frame == None: 160 frame = DensityWindow(base=self.parent, manager=self) 161 self.put_icon(frame) 165 frame = DensityWindow(parent=self.parent, 166 base=self.parent, manager=self) 167 #self.put_icon(frame) 162 168 self.cal_md_frame = frame 163 self.cal_md_frame.Show(False) 169 else: 170 self.cal_md_frame.Show(False) 164 171 self.cal_md_frame.Show(True) 165 172 … … 170 177 if self.cal_slit_frame == None: 171 178 frame = SlitLengthCalculatorWindow(parent=self.parent, manager=self) 172 self.put_icon(frame)179 #self.put_icon(frame) 173 180 self.cal_slit_frame = frame 174 self.cal_slit_frame.Show(False) 181 else: 182 self.cal_slit_frame.Show(False) 175 183 self.cal_slit_frame.Show(True) 176 184 … … 183 191 self.put_icon(frame) 184 192 self.cal_res_frame = frame 185 self.cal_res_frame.Show(False) 193 else: 194 self.cal_res_frame.Show(False) 186 195 self.cal_res_frame.Show(True) 187 196 … … 192 201 if self.gen_frame == None: 193 202 frame = SasGenWindow(parent=self.parent, manager=self) 194 self.put_icon(frame)203 #self.put_icon(frame) 195 204 self.gen_frame = frame 196 self.gen_frame.Show(False) 205 else: 206 self.gen_frame.Show(False) 197 207 self.gen_frame.Show(True) 198 208 … … 225 235 self.put_icon(frame) 226 236 self.py_frame = frame 227 self.py_frame.Show(False) 237 else: 238 self.py_frame.Show(False) 228 239 self.py_frame.Show(True) 229 240 -
calculatorview/src/sans/perspectives/calculator/data_operator.py
rae84427 r7aa1685 934 934 self.draw() 935 935 936 class DataOperatorWindow(wx. Frame):936 class DataOperatorWindow(wx.MDIChildFrame): 937 937 def __init__(self, parent, manager, *args, **kwds): 938 938 kwds["size"] = (PANEL_WIDTH, PANEL_HEIGTH) 939 wx. Frame.__init__(self, parent, *args, **kwds)939 wx.MDIChildFrame.__init__(self, parent, *args, **kwds) 940 940 self.parent = parent 941 941 self.manager = manager 942 942 self.panel = DataOperPanel(parent=self) 943 943 wx.EVT_CLOSE(self, self.OnClose) 944 self.CenterOnParent() 944 #self.CenterOnParent() 945 self.SetPosition((0, 0)) 945 946 self.Show() 946 947 -
calculatorview/src/sans/perspectives/calculator/density_panel.py
rae84427 r7aa1685 371 371 return output.lstrip().rstrip() 372 372 373 class DensityWindow(wx. Frame):373 class DensityWindow(wx.MDIChildFrame): 374 374 """ 375 375 """ … … 381 381 kwds['title'] = title 382 382 kwds['size'] = size 383 wx. Frame.__init__(self, parent, *args, **kwds)383 wx.MDIChildFrame.__init__(self, parent, *args, **kwds) 384 384 """ 385 385 """ … … 387 387 self.panel = DensityPanel(self, base=base) 388 388 self.Bind(wx.EVT_CLOSE, self.on_close) 389 self.Centre() 389 #self.Centre() 390 self.SetPosition((0, 0)) 390 391 self.Show(True) 391 392 -
calculatorview/src/sans/perspectives/calculator/gen_scatter_panel.py
rae84427 r7aa1685 1791 1791 return flag 1792 1792 1793 class SasGenWindow(wx. Frame):1793 class SasGenWindow(wx.MDIChildFrame): 1794 1794 """ 1795 1795 GEN SAS main window … … 1800 1800 Init 1801 1801 """ 1802 if parent != None: 1803 # set max size depending up on client size 1804 wth, hgt = parent.get_client_size() 1805 if hgt < size[1]: 1806 size = (size[0], hgt) 1807 if wth < size[0]: 1808 size = (wth, size[1]) 1802 1809 kwds['size'] = size 1803 1810 kwds['title'] = title 1804 1805 wx.Frame.__init__(self, parent, *args, **kwds) 1811 wx.MDIChildFrame.__init__(self, parent, *args, **kwds) 1806 1812 self.parent = parent 1807 1813 self.base = manager … … 1822 1828 1823 1829 self.build_panels() 1824 self.Centre() 1830 #self.Centre() 1831 self.SetPosition((0, 0)) 1825 1832 self.Show(True) 1826 1833 … … 2004 2011 """ 2005 2012 """ 2013 from sans.guiframe.events import NewPlotEvent 2014 wx.PostEvent(self.parent, NewPlotEvent(plot=plot, title=title)) 2015 """ 2006 2016 frame = PlotFrame(self, -1, 'testView', self.scale2d) 2007 2017 add_icon(self.parent, frame) … … 2010 2020 frame.Show(True) 2011 2021 frame.SetFocus() 2012 2022 """ 2013 2023 def set_schedule_full_draw(self, panel=None, func='del'): 2014 2024 """ -
calculatorview/src/sans/perspectives/calculator/kiessig_calculator_panel.py
rae84427 r7aa1685 190 190 self.on_compute(event) 191 191 192 class KiessigWindow(wx. Frame):192 class KiessigWindow(wx.MDIChildFrame): 193 193 def __init__(self, parent=None, manager=None, 194 194 title="Kiessig Thickness Calculator", … … 196 196 kwds['title'] = title 197 197 kwds['size'] = size 198 wx. Frame.__init__(self, parent, *args, **kwds)198 wx.MDIChildFrame.__init__(self, parent, *args, **kwds) 199 199 self.parent = parent 200 200 self.manager = manager 201 201 self.panel = KiessigThicknessCalculatorPanel(parent=self) 202 202 self.Bind(wx.EVT_CLOSE, self.on_close) 203 self.Centre() 203 #self.Centre() 204 self.SetPosition((0, 0)) 204 205 self.Show(True) 205 206 -
calculatorview/src/sans/perspectives/calculator/resolution_calculator_panel.py
rae84427 r7aa1685 823 823 if self.image != None: 824 824 #_pylab_helpers.Gcf.set_active(self.fm) 825 _pylab_helpers.Gcf.figs = {} 825 826 # Clear the image before redraw 826 827 self.image.clf() … … 1389 1390 raise 1390 1391 1391 class ResolutionWindow(wx. Frame):1392 class ResolutionWindow(wx.MDIChildFrame): 1392 1393 """ 1393 1394 Resolution Window … … 1396 1397 title = "SANS Resolution Estimator", 1397 1398 size=(PANEL_WIDTH * 2, PANEL_HEIGHT), *args, **kwds): 1399 if parent != None: 1400 # set max size depending up on client size 1401 wth, hgt = parent.get_client_size() 1402 if hgt < size[1]: 1403 size = (size[0], hgt) 1404 if wth < size[0]: 1405 size = (wth, size[1]) 1398 1406 kwds['title'] = title 1399 1407 kwds['size'] = size 1400 wx. Frame.__init__(self, parent=None, *args, **kwds)1408 wx.MDIChildFrame.__init__(self, parent=parent, *args, **kwds) 1401 1409 self.parent = parent 1402 1410 self.manager = manager 1403 1411 self.panel = ResolutionCalculatorPanel(parent=self) 1404 1412 self.Bind(wx.EVT_CLOSE, self.OnClose) 1405 self.Centre() 1413 self.SetPosition((0, 0)) 1414 #self.Center() 1406 1415 self.Show(True) 1407 1416 -
calculatorview/src/sans/perspectives/calculator/sld_panel.py
rae84427 r7aa1685 437 437 438 438 439 class SldWindow(wx. Frame):439 class SldWindow(wx.MDIChildFrame): 440 440 """ 441 441 """ … … 447 447 kwds['title'] = title 448 448 kwds['size'] = size 449 wx. Frame.__init__(self, parent, *args, **kwds)449 wx.MDIChildFrame.__init__(self, parent, *args, **kwds) 450 450 """ 451 451 """ … … 455 455 self.panel = SldPanel(self, base=base) 456 456 self.Bind(wx.EVT_CLOSE, self.on_close) 457 self.Centre() 457 #self.Centre() 458 self.SetPosition((0, 0)) 458 459 self.Show(True) 459 460 -
calculatorview/src/sans/perspectives/calculator/slit_length_calculator_panel.py
rae84427 r7aa1685 251 251 252 252 253 class SlitLengthCalculatorWindow(wx. Frame):253 class SlitLengthCalculatorWindow(wx.MDIChildFrame): 254 254 """ 255 255 """ … … 260 260 kwds['size']= size 261 261 kwds['title']= title 262 wx. Frame.__init__(self, parent, *args, **kwds)262 wx.MDIChildFrame.__init__(self, parent, *args, **kwds) 263 263 self.parent = parent 264 264 self.manager = manager 265 265 self.panel = SlitLengthCalculatorPanel(parent=self) 266 266 self.Bind(wx.EVT_CLOSE, self.on_close) 267 self.Centre() 267 #self.Centre() 268 self.SetPosition((0, 0)) 268 269 self.Show(True) 269 270
Note: See TracChangeset
for help on using the changeset viewer.